Webb2 nov. 2010 · of early childhood child-centered curriculums are that a child is able to separate from his/her parents, be curious and explore the environment, actively engage with the materials offered, play independently, be social, express him/her self, make decisions, etc. (Bredekamp & Copple, 1997). WebbEarly educational interventions, such as Head Start, have been widely recognized as an effective way to mitigate the negative effects of poverty on early learning and development (Camilli, Vargas, Ryan, & Barnett, 2010). In the past decade, there has been a strong expansion of early childhood programming, including Head Start and state-funded …

Webbför 2 dagar sedan · From an early age, the bond between father and child must cultivate security, attachment, stimulation, and activation. Final comments. The father-child activation relationship theory suggests that the involvement of fathers in their children’s upbringing right from the start is crucial for their good psychological development.
